Some TR 6 drivers are using the following parts:
Clutch automat Sachs # 3082 100 041 (earlier LUK # 122 006 212) Clutch disk Luk # 322 0135 16 KYK (Toyota) Release baering

Thanks everyone.
We have removed the bearing and polished the inside real hard.
Put it back with copper grease.
Since then drove 300 miles without problem.
